Is it an exocet he has modified? No. He bought a roller bender, and built his own chassis from start to finish. Just a one-off car. His car still uses miata subframes, engine, trans, wiring harness, and steering from a Miata just like an exocet. Way too much work for a guy like me. Turned out nice though, in my opinion. He let me drive it. It's kind of like a lighter version of a miata. The sides are really wide open, makes you feel connected to the road.
